Correspondence with Agent-General ... being Copies of Correspondence between the Agent-General and the Hon. the Treasurer, and also between the Agent-General and Mr Purdy and others relative to Newspaper Criticisms on the Public Debt of this Colony and the Government Northern Territory Policy

Adelaide, Government Printer, 1869.

Foolscap folio, 44 pages.

Drop-title, all edges uncut; four small holes in the inner margins where stab-sewn when bound (now disbound); tiny stain to the leading edge of a few leaves; an excellent copy.

South Australian Parliamentary Paper Number 148 of 1869-70. Francis Dutton, the Agent-General for South Australia in London, certainly earned his salary that year; if nothing else, the correspondence is VERY detailed.
